Can I Vote In The General Election By Post?
Politics There is a system called postal voting in place in the United Kingdom. Anyone who can vote in person is able to apply for a postal vote instead. There is an application form you can download and send to your local electoral registration office if you want to register for postal voting. The link to the form (correct at time of writing) is: http://www.aboutmyvote.co.uk/register_to_vote/postal_vote_application.aspx A postal vote applies for one election (or specified time period). Some people are worried about the security of postal votes and knowing who really makes them; however it is against the law to try to influence how someone else fills in their postal vote or indeed to vote on their behalf.
